diff mbox series

[v2] dt-bindings: input: ti-tsc-adc: Add new compatible for AM654 SoCs

Message ID 20190108052631.4169-1-vigneshr@ti.com (mailing list archive)
State Mainlined
Commit 5bb57a7488c64a391107b2002d4e1f7d6bda00aa
Headers show
Series [v2] dt-bindings: input: ti-tsc-adc: Add new compatible for AM654 SoCs | expand

Commit Message

Vignesh Raghavendra Jan. 8, 2019, 5:26 a.m. UTC
AM654 SoCs has ADC IP which is similar to AM335x, but without the
touchscreen part. Add new compatible to handle AM654 SoCs. Also, it
seems that existing compatible strings used in the kernel DTs were never
documented. So, document them now.

Signed-off-by: Vignesh R <vigneshr@ti.com>
Reviewed-by: Rob Herring <robh@kernel.org>
---
v2:
Fix subject line to include subsystem name
Rebase onto v5.0-rc1
v1: https://lkml.org/lkml/2018/11/19/313

 .../devicetree/bindings/input/touchscreen/ti-tsc-adc.txt  | 8 ++++++++
 1 file changed, 8 insertions(+)

Comments

Vignesh Raghavendra Feb. 11, 2019, 5:40 a.m. UTC | #1
Hi Dmitry,

On 08/01/19 10:56 AM, Vignesh R wrote:
> AM654 SoCs has ADC IP which is similar to AM335x, but without the
> touchscreen part. Add new compatible to handle AM654 SoCs. Also, it
> seems that existing compatible strings used in the kernel DTs were never
> documented. So, document them now.
> 
> Signed-off-by: Vignesh R <vigneshr@ti.com>
> Reviewed-by: Rob Herring <robh@kernel.org>
> ---

If there are no comments, could you queue this bindings patch? This will
help me in getting ADC DT nodes to be merged into ARM SoC tree.

Regards
Vignesh

> v2:
> Fix subject line to include subsystem name
> Rebase onto v5.0-rc1
> v1: https://lkml.org/lkml/2018/11/19/313
> 
>  .../devicetree/bindings/input/touchscreen/ti-tsc-adc.txt  | 8 ++++++++
>  1 file changed, 8 insertions(+)
> 
> diff --git a/Documentation/devicetree/bindings/input/touchscreen/ti-tsc-adc.txt b/Documentation/devicetree/bindings/input/touchscreen/ti-tsc-adc.txt
> index b1163bf97146..aad5e34965eb 100644
> --- a/Documentation/devicetree/bindings/input/touchscreen/ti-tsc-adc.txt
> +++ b/Documentation/devicetree/bindings/input/touchscreen/ti-tsc-adc.txt
> @@ -2,7 +2,12 @@
>  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
>  
>  Required properties:
> +- mfd
> +	compatible: Should be
> +		"ti,am3359-tscadc" for AM335x/AM437x SoCs
> +		"ti,am654-tscadc", "ti,am3359-tscadc" for AM654 SoCs
>  - child "tsc"
> +	compatible: Should be "ti,am3359-tsc".
>  	ti,wires: Wires refer to application modes i.e. 4/5/8 wire touchscreen
>  		  support on the platform.
>  	ti,x-plate-resistance: X plate resistance
> @@ -25,6 +30,9 @@ Required properties:
>  			AIN0 = 0, AIN1 = 1 and so on till AIN7 = 7.
>  			XP  = 0, XN = 1, YP = 2, YN = 3.
>  - child "adc"
> +	compatible: Should be
> +		    "ti,am3359-adc" for AM335x/AM437x SoCs
> +		    "ti,am654-adc", "ti,am3359-adc" for AM654 SoCs
>  	ti,adc-channels: List of analog inputs available for ADC.
>  			 AIN0 = 0, AIN1 = 1 and so on till AIN7 = 7.
>  
>
Dmitry Torokhov Feb. 11, 2019, 10:10 p.m. UTC | #2
Hi Vignesh,

On Mon, Feb 11, 2019 at 11:10:59AM +0530, Vignesh R wrote:
> Hi Dmitry,
> 
> On 08/01/19 10:56 AM, Vignesh R wrote:
> > AM654 SoCs has ADC IP which is similar to AM335x, but without the
> > touchscreen part. Add new compatible to handle AM654 SoCs. Also, it
> > seems that existing compatible strings used in the kernel DTs were never
> > documented. So, document them now.
> > 
> > Signed-off-by: Vignesh R <vigneshr@ti.com>
> > Reviewed-by: Rob Herring <robh@kernel.org>
> > ---
> 
> If there are no comments, could you queue this bindings patch? This will
> help me in getting ADC DT nodes to be merged into ARM SoC tree.

Sorry I did not realize you waited for me. Yes, please feel free to
merge through your tree.

Acked-by: Dmitry Torokhov <dmitry.torokhov@gmail.com>

Thanks,
diff mbox series

Patch

diff --git a/Documentation/devicetree/bindings/input/touchscreen/ti-tsc-adc.txt b/Documentation/devicetree/bindings/input/touchscreen/ti-tsc-adc.txt
index b1163bf97146..aad5e34965eb 100644
--- a/Documentation/devicetree/bindings/input/touchscreen/ti-tsc-adc.txt
+++ b/Documentation/devicetree/bindings/input/touchscreen/ti-tsc-adc.txt
@@ -2,7 +2,12 @@ 
 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
 
 Required properties:
+- mfd
+	compatible: Should be
+		"ti,am3359-tscadc" for AM335x/AM437x SoCs
+		"ti,am654-tscadc", "ti,am3359-tscadc" for AM654 SoCs
 - child "tsc"
+	compatible: Should be "ti,am3359-tsc".
 	ti,wires: Wires refer to application modes i.e. 4/5/8 wire touchscreen
 		  support on the platform.
 	ti,x-plate-resistance: X plate resistance
@@ -25,6 +30,9 @@  Required properties:
 			AIN0 = 0, AIN1 = 1 and so on till AIN7 = 7.
 			XP  = 0, XN = 1, YP = 2, YN = 3.
 - child "adc"
+	compatible: Should be
+		    "ti,am3359-adc" for AM335x/AM437x SoCs
+		    "ti,am654-adc", "ti,am3359-adc" for AM654 SoCs
 	ti,adc-channels: List of analog inputs available for ADC.
 			 AIN0 = 0, AIN1 = 1 and so on till AIN7 = 7.